This film is an animated film co produced by Shou Oshii. Won the Best Feature Award at the 2002 Stuttgart International Animation Film Festival and the Animation Award at the 2001 Japan Cultural Agency Media Art Festival. In the autumn of 1966, during the Vietnam War, at the United States Air Force Yokota Base in Japan
